The Child (1977) tells of a young woman who becomes the caretaker for a strange little girl living in a remote countryside home. As eerie events unfold, she discovers the child possesses a terrifying power to summon the undead to avenge her mother’s death. This low-budget horror combines gothic atmosphere, rural isolation, and a haunting sense of supernatural menace.
